What is LPG And exactly how is it built?
LPG stands for liquefied petroleum fuel and it is a type of 'liquid gasoline' that can be applied as fuel for a range of reasons, including powering automobiles.
Also referred to as butane and propane gas, or autogas in motoring circles, it's the by-product on the processing of natural fuel liquids together with the refining of crude oil.
Whilst ordinarily it absolutely was intentionally burnt off and wasted, in the last few a long time it's been recognised as a versatile very low-carbon gasoline – and utilized productively.
Although the phrase ‘liquid gas’ appears to get a contradiction in conditions, it basically describes a transparent fuel that turns to liquid when subjected to pressure or cooling: it’s this characteristic that permits it for being stored in tanks in the car or truck.
Most petrol cars and trucks can be equipped having an LPG (Liquid Petroleum Fuel) conversion, turning them into ‘twin-gas autos’ which can operate on LPG together with petrol. Some models, which include Dacia, have bought conversions within the manufacturing facility.

Why can it be not more broadly used?
Though LPG is greatly used by properties and enterprises, under a person percent of automobiles on United kingdom roadways are fuelled by it.
There are a number of explanations why Lots of individuals are unwilling to transform their car to run on LPG but among the most important explanations is The dearth of incentives more info in the UK Authorities.
Despite the fact that autos converted by accredited corporations may well qualify to save lots of on car or truck excise responsibility (VED), by staying classed being an ‘alternatively-fuelled’ auto, the newest principles suggest these only conserve £ten per annum on street tax.
Very similar to electric cars and trucks, it’s a ‘rooster and egg’ situation. With LPG-transformed automobiles symbolizing these kinds of a small proportion of all vehicles on British isles roads, there’s little incentive for filling stations to provide LPG. And if it’s difficult to find filling stations stocking it, motorists is going to be reluctant to transform to LPG.
A lot of people don’t comprehend the advantages and disadvantages of jogging an LPG automobile. With no very same incentives as electric powered automobiles, LPG simply isn’t staying promoted in the UK. A lot of motorists merely aren’t mindful of its existence.
Motorists may also be worried about the expenditure. Converting a petrol auto to operate on LPG can cost approximately £2,000, and there’s no assure with the British isles federal government that it received’t elevate obligations on LPG in the future. The price of LPG has also enhanced significantly in the final handful of decades, slashing prospective discounts.
This uncertainty might make it difficult to promote an LPG-converted automobile, that means you’ll battle to Get the a reimbursement if you need to do pay for a conversion after which market the car.
Though a number of auto suppliers have in past times experimented with featuring manufacturing unit-in shape LPG kits on new types (chances are you'll uncover ‘dual-gasoline’ Fords, Dacias, Vauxhalls, Protons and Saabs during the classifieds), all of them offered in little quantities and, as a result, only Dacia sells new LPG converted cars and trucks currently.

How available is LPG?
One more reason why A lot of people are unwilling to convert their car or truck to run on LPG is The problem find fuel stations that deliver it.
Based on the United kingdom trade Affiliation with the LPG sector, UKLPG, you will find 1,400 LPG refuelling stations across the country compared to all around eight,350 filling stations General.
Which means it’s tougher to locate LPG than petrol or diesel, particularly if you live in a very rural area the place filling stations are scarcer.
It is actually obtaining simpler to Find LPG stockists, while. There are now many Sites and cellular phone applications demonstrating your closest LPG company, and perhaps permitting you compare costs.
Numerous the big fuel station chains sometimes provide LPG, such as Shell, BP and Esso, as do supermarket petrol stations, notably some Morrisons and Sainsbury’s stations.
